风险管理是一项相对独立的具有目的性的质量活动,也可以是其它质量活动中的一项评估工具。但是在

Risk management is a relatively independent and purposeful quality activity, and can also be an evaluation tool in other quality activities. But in the

验证方案中并不是必需风险评估过程,更没有必要每个方案中都描述风险评估的原理、方法、评分标准、风险控制流程……这些应该在风险管理的工作流程

The risk assessment process is not necessary in the validation plan, nor is it necessary to describe the principles, methods, scoring standards, and risk control processes of risk assessment in each plan... These should be included in the risk management workflow

文件中规范。也没必要在方案中描述失效模式评估过程与评估结论……这些也是需要起草单独的文件,用于设备或系统的风险识别、失效模式风险评估,主要用于采取措施降低风险,对相关部件重点进行确认验证。可以不单独对“计算机控制系统”硬件软件进行评估,应该是对计算机“化”系统的整个“设备系统”在生产工艺流程中的失效模式评估。验证方案中只列出“风险评估结论”和需要确认验证的“范围程度”即可。

Specification in the document. There is no need to describe the failure mode assessment process and conclusions in the plan... These also require drafting separate documents for risk identification of equipment or systems, failure mode risk assessment, mainly for taking measures to reduce risks, and confirming and verifying relevant components. It is not necessary to evaluate the hardware and software of the "computer control system" separately, but rather to evaluate the failure modes of the entire "equipment system" in the production process of the "computerized" system. Only the "risk assessment conclusion" and the "degree of scope" that needs to be confirmed for validation can be listed in the validation plan.

关于计算机“化”系统验证确认方案

On the Verification and Confirmation Scheme of Computer "Modernization" System

既然是计算机“化”系统确认与验证,就不单单是“计算机控制系统”硬件软件的确认与验证,那么也没必要单独起草“计算机控制系统”的验证确认方案。只需要在原来“设备系统”的确认与验证文件的基础上增加“计算机控制系统”的“基础构架的确认”和“应用软件的验证”内容,对于计算机控制的设备、系统而言,也不存在独立于设备之外的计算机系统验证。如果是因为以前做过的设备确认验证中没有认真做计算机控制部件的确认,那么你想补充确认计算机系统硬件软件,也是可以的,但严格说并不是单独的一类验证。

Since it is the confirmation and verification of computerized systems, it is not just the confirmation and verification of hardware and software of computer control systems. Therefore, there is no need to draft a separate verification and confirmation plan for computer control systems. It is only necessary to add the content of "infrastructure confirmation" and "application software verification" of "computer control system" to the original confirmation and verification files of "equipment system". For computer controlled equipment and systems, there is no independent computer system verification outside of the equipment. If it is due to the lack of careful confirmation of computer control components in previous equipment validation, it is also possible to supplement the confirmation of computer system hardware and software, but strictly speaking, it is not a separate type of validation.

关于“计算机控制系统”硬件软件的确认与验证

Confirmation and Verification of Hardware and Software for "Computer Control System"

这一部分虽然不需要单独拿出来做,但是很多企业还是会单独做,那么如果你的计算机“化”系统的“设备系统”已经做了确认和验证的,单独做计算机控制系统的硬件软件的确认就是重复劳动,没有必要。在“设备系统”的确认与验证中增加的“计算机控制系统”硬件软件的确认与验证,遵循GAMP5

Although this part does not need to be done separately, many companies still do it separately. Therefore, if the "equipment system" of your computer "transformation" system has already been confirmed and verified, doing the hardware and software confirmation of the computer control system separately is repetitive work and unnecessary. The confirmation and verification of the hardware and software of the "computer control system" added in the confirmation and verification of the "equipment system" follows GAMP5
